diff options
Diffstat (limited to 'dcaedt_be/src/test/java/org/onap/sdc/dcae/rule/editor/impl/RulesBusinessLogicTest.java')
-rw-r--r-- | dcaedt_be/src/test/java/org/onap/sdc/dcae/rule/editor/impl/RulesBusinessLogicTest.java | 9 |
1 files changed, 8 insertions, 1 deletions
diff --git a/dcaedt_be/src/test/java/org/onap/sdc/dcae/rule/editor/impl/RulesBusinessLogicTest.java b/dcaedt_be/src/test/java/org/onap/sdc/dcae/rule/editor/impl/RulesBusinessLogicTest.java index 3b7181d..f7d7ed0 100644 --- a/dcaedt_be/src/test/java/org/onap/sdc/dcae/rule/editor/impl/RulesBusinessLogicTest.java +++ b/dcaedt_be/src/test/java/org/onap/sdc/dcae/rule/editor/impl/RulesBusinessLogicTest.java @@ -68,10 +68,17 @@ public class RulesBusinessLogicTest { rule.getActions().add(buildCopyAction("2.0","event.commonEventHeader.version")); rule.setDescription("description"); rule.setPhase("phase_1"); - rule.setNotifyId("someValue"); rule.setEntryPhase("foi_map"); rule.setPublishPhase("map_publish"); MappingRules mr = new MappingRules(rule); + Condition condition = new Condition(); + condition.setLeft("${notify OID}"); + condition.getRight().add("someValue"); + condition.setOperator("startsWith"); + condition.setId("id"); + condition.setLevel("4"); + condition.setName("3"); + mr.setFilter(condition); List<ServiceException> errors = rulesBusinessLogic.validateRulesBeforeTranslate(mr); assertTrue(errors.isEmpty()); assertEquals(expectedTranslation, rulesBusinessLogic.translateRules(mr)); |